The stakes are at an all-time high as Liniers prepares to take on Real Pilar in what promises to be a heavyweight clash in the Primera B Metropolitana's Clausura. With Real Pilar perched ominously in second place with 37 points, they have their sights set firmly on the title. Meanwhile, Liniers finds itself fighting for survival in 16th place with only 23 points, desperately seeking momentum amidst fluctuating form. It's a classic case of the underdog versus the powerhouse - can Liniers pull off a monumental upset against a team that has been nothing short of formidable this season?
Liniers heads into this match buoyed by their recent narrow win over UAI Urquiza, a vital boost after suffering two consecutive defeats prior to that victory. The gritty defense will need to maintain that same focus and discipline against Real Pilar, who boasts an attacking prowess capable of dismantling defenses. On the flip side, Real Pilar continues its impressive run, winning three out of their last five matches, including a solid performance against Comunicaciones where they secured a 2-1 victory. Their well-drilled tactical approach focuses on maintaining possession and exploiting gaps in opposing defenses - an approach that could put Liniers under serious pressure.
Let's delve deeper into each team's statistics. Liniers has managed to score just 13 goals in 19 matches while conceding 24 - numbers that underline their struggles in attack and vulnerability at the back. The absence of consistent goal-scoring has left them scrambling for points. Their recent matches have shown glimpses of improvement defensively but still lack clinical finishing when opportunities arise; highlighted by their single-goal victories, which show potential but also reflect an ongoing inability to convert chances consistently.
Conversely, Real Pilar has emerged as one of the league's offensive juggernauts with 26 goals scored across the same number of fixtures and only 10 conceded-an indication of their strength at both ends of the pitch. They average about 14 shots per game while allowing only around eight from opponents. This discrepancy reveals not just defensive solidity but also tactical awareness; they know how to control games effectively through superior midfield play and pressing tactics that stifle opposition buildup.
Look for key battles on the field where players like Fernando Valenzuela, who recently scored twice against San Martín Burzaco and leads Real Pilar's scoring charts, will look to exploit any lapses from Liniers' backline. On the other hand, if Agustin Ruiz, who netted crucial goals recently for Liniers, can find his rhythm early on, he may yet prove pivotal in securing points for his struggling side.
As we look ahead to this encounter at Juan Antonio Arias Stadium, one cannot overlook head-to-head history. In recent matchups between these two teams, Real Pilar tends to come out on top more often than not; however, underestimating Liniers-especially when playing at home-could be catastrophic for them.
